The Awful Grace of God

Religious Terrorism, White Supremacy, and the Unsolved Murder of Martin Luther King, Jr.

Focusing on the chilling conspiracy to assassinate Martin Luther King Jr., the book reveals the violent efforts of right-wing extremists over several years. It provides in-depth research on key figures such as Sam Bowers, the KKK leader notorious for his violent acts, J.B. Stoner, a prominent ultra-right activist, and Reverend Wesley Swift, whose radical teachings influenced many. The work sheds light on the dark undercurrents of American extremism during this tumultuous period, offering a thorough documentation of their threats against civil rights.
